Assistant Coach (Major Sport) coaches and demonstrates athletic team with skills, techniques, and strategies for maximum athletic performance. Analyzes player performance to determine improvement plan for the group or individual player. Being an Assistant Coach (Major Sport) provides skill demonstrations of sport coached. Must be familiar with NCAA rules and regulations. Additionally, Assistant Coach (Major Sport) requires a bachelor's degree in the related area. Typically reports to a head coach. The Assistant Coach (Major Sport) contributes to moderately complex aspects of a project. Work is generally independent and collaborative in nature. To be an Assistant Coach (Major Sport) typically requires 4 to 7 years of related experience. (Copyright 2024 Salary.com)
